There’s an interconnectedness in scripture that is often lost to us when we read it purely literally, a tendency of both Hebrew and Christian bibles to use recurring images and symbols to point to deeper spiritual truth. This multilayered structure is often made plain by the gospels themselves, but in our desire to use scripture for our own purposes and avoid personal reflection we never seek these threads nor see where they lead. One example of these spiritual symbols is the number 40 (which I mention regularly), often used to describe a state of temptation in scripture, just as Christ is said to have spent 40 days in the wilderness overcoming three key temptations from the Devil.
